Have you jumped on the Rose Gold train yet? This past Spring, Rose Gold became a new obsession in the fashion world. From handbags to shoes and accessories, it's been the total rage. With the abundance of this pale copper colored metal, many watches have been launched in this girly hue. Just about every watch brand has a few Rose Gold options, but you can find the biggest selection of styles from Michael Kors. The average retail for a Michael Kors watch is $250. Some styles are a little more expensive, and a select few may be a pinch less. Out of all of the department store brands, the least expensive one I've come across is from Fossil. Number 8 in the above photo is a very cute option for half the price of a Kors at $135.

Now, if that's a lot to invest in for you right now, you have other options. When I'm low on funds, eBay is my best friend.

If you search eBay, sorting the search results by the lowest price first, you'll see a lot of results for Rose Gold Watches from Hong Kong. I have ordered jewelry in the past from Hong Kong, but I dread the lengthy shipping time, especially with something I'm really looking forward to receiving. Yes, I'm very impatient.

Sally Hansen Xtreme Wear Nail Color in Rockstar Pink!


Rockstar Pink is a pretty cool glitter polish that consists of two different size glitters. I wouldn't really consider it to be "chunky" glitter, but it's a mix of small and extra fine glitters. There are magenta, red, blue and very fine gold (they almost look green - some say they are silver, but they look gold to me) glitter, with the majority being magenta. Wow, I've managed to say glitter 5 times in two sentences. Haha!

Anyway, many times glitter nail polishes disappoint because they never seem to look the same way on the nail as they do in the bottle. Although Rockstar Pink is fairly sheer, I find it to be more opaque than other glitters I've tried in the past. You pretty much get full coverage with three coats, but I decided on four. When sealed with a top coat, this polish is a real stunner.

I tried it over pink, black and solo. I think it looks pretty cool all three ways. A couple of pedicures ago, I did the pink version and I loved it. It looked very "barbie-esque".

If you love glitter polish and don't mind the extra hassle of removing it, this is a great buy for a couple of dollars at your local drugstore.
